At the heart of AI lies the concept of an algorithm. An algorithm is essentially a step-by-step procedure or formula for solving a problem. In the context of AI, algorithms are used to process data, identify patterns, learn from that data, and make decisions based on the knowledge gained.

AI algorithms differ from traditional algorithms in that they often involve learning and adaptation. Traditional algorithms are rule-based, meaning that the instructions are explicitly programmed and fixed. AI algorithms, particularly in machine learning, are designed to improve over time by learning from data. They can adjust their behavior based on new information, becoming more accurate and efficient as they process more data.
